Abstract:

A model for the interaction of a short laser with matter is presented. The model is based on the solution of wave-propagation equations in a medium with complex dielectric constant. The model is coupled with multigroup radiation hydrodynamics to take into account the space and time evolution of plasma parameters. The complete code is used to analyze various experiments with laser pulse duration varying from 150 fs to 5 ps and laser intensity varying from 1012 W/cm2 to 1017 W/cm2. The model is also used to study the enhancement in absorption with prepulse
